Got my inner eye pressure tested again this morning and all is well. It actually went down. Given the antics of my ophthalmologist in Montreal, I'm betting that his head was up his ass (or headed in that general direction) when he told me that my IEP was elevated that last time. Anyway, its been measured twice by 3 different people here and it's well normal, so I'm happy about that.

I'm working from home today, cause my appointment made me miss my shuttle to the EBI and there's no real way to get there unless I take a very costly cab. So, working from home.

Surreal moment of the day: as I was waiting for the bus, a plane flew ovearhead. Now given that Stansted airport is close by, that's not really an unexpected event. This one was different though. The noise was so loud that I could feel the engines screaming in the pit of my stomach and when i looked up, it filled my field of vision. I thought it would crash just beyond the neighborhood. In the absence of a big boom and a column of flame, I'm assuming that it made it ok but dayum, that's impressive.
